Chinese Rittal
Since the 90s of the last century, the German Rittal has settled in China, and the company name is Rittal Electronic Machinery Technology (Shanghai) Co., Ltd., (hereinafter referred to as Rittal). In 2004, Rittal opened a new high-tech production site in the Chinese metropolis of Shanghai, which played a major role in the further growth of the Chinese market. With a production base of more than 28,000 square meters, it has become one of the world's most advanced high-tech production bases for cabinets and chassis. With a total investment area of 110,000 square metres, there is ample room for further expansion of the Rittal area. It is also Rittal's high-tech hub in Asia, with a production site with a broad product portfolio, including a wide range of products that are used internationally, and a comprehensive quality management system that guarantees consistently high quality products. All components produced in Shanghai are tested according to international regulations and standards. Rittal has 29 distribution centres in China, employs more than 1,000 people, and has nine large warehouse sites in Shanghai, Beijing, Tianjin, Shenzhen, Shenyang, Xi'an, Wuhan and Chengdu.
